Package: SeekIT
System name: seekit
Type: GNU
Description:
The purpose of my project is to have a tool on a linux machine, that help us to
find those things we can't remember where they are, instead of having to search
through all yor media collection.
It's being developed using C# and the Mono compiler, in order to get OS
portability. It has also been splited into different parts, which aloow as to
reimplement some of these parts, making them act as if they were plugins. For
example, the user interface can be a GTK one a web one, or whatever kind could
think of.
Furthermore it internally works with XML data, making it easy to translate it
into another formats like HTML, PDF ... (TODO)
Source code can be found on SourceForge cvs repository, and can also be found
on http://www.aditel.org/~dpecos/projects/seekit/bin/seekit-0.6.tar.gz
Other Software Required:
mono, gtk-sharp, make
